Crossman, Edgar O. was born on December 15, 1864 in Windsor Company, Vermont, United States. Son of Ezra Crossman.
Education common schools, Plymouth, Vermont and New Hampshire (U.S.) State College. Graduate medical department, Vermont University, 1887. Postgraduate courses New York Post-Graduate Medical School and Harvard.
Member several local medical societies and board of trustees New Hampshire (U.S.) Insane Hospital. Chairman Lisbon (New Hampshire (U.S.)) board education. Medical superintendent Markleton, Pennsylvania, Sanitorium.
Contributor to medical and other journals.
Wrote: Morphinism in Neurasthenia, Baltimore Medical Journal, 1899. The Early Diagnosis and Treatment Melancholia, The Stylus Medical Journal.
Temperance from a Medical Standpoint, Presbyterian Banner, 1900. Residence: Lisbon, New Hampshire (U.S.)
